Web20 mai 2024 · Endometrial cancer begins in the layer of cells that form the lining (endometrium) of the uterus. Endometrial cancer is sometimes called uterine cancer. … Web1 oct. 2024 · Case 3. A 36-year-old immunocompromised woman presented with persistent severe dyskaryosis on cervical cytology. A total hysterectomy revealed incidental cystic areas within the fundal myometrium. Histology demonstrated a loculated myometrial cyst lined by flattened cuboidal cells measuring 20 mm in maximum dimension.

Typical findings: Thickened endometrium with multiple cystic spaces giving a “Swiss cheese’ pattern”. Polyps will be seen as echogenic lesions with a vascular stalk. Hysterosonography can be used as a problem solving tool. happy birthday image png
